Frequently Asked Questions about Ridgecrest
What type of rentals are currently available in Ridgecrest?
There are currently 62 Apartments for Rent in Ridgecrest, CA with pricing that ranges from $850 to $2,200. There are also 41 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Ridgecrest ranging from $950 to $87,300.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Ridgecrest?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Ridgecrest ranges from $950 to $87,300 with an average monthly rent of $2,539.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Ridgecrest?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Ridgecrest range from $1,250 to $1,875,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,100 to $87,300.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,800.
